    It's the Nigel Benn farce all over again. People remember the fighter they loved to watch in their prime, not the shot, tired shell of a boxer in their last fights before hanging up the gloves. They then think that years away from training have magically restored the guy.

    These videos are carefully shot to create a particular image. They look in great shape. Boxing however doesn't allow you to call 'cut' after 20 seconds and reset.

    Maybe the nostalgia is enough for some. For me, the reasons I love boxing are the reasons I don't want to see these guys in the ring again.
